The opposite of compassion

Someone asked me, "What do you think the opposite of compassion is?" I nervously replied, "coldness".

He then went on. "Most people think that the opposite of compassion is apathy, callousness, coldness. But I think it's competitiveness."

Whoa, this is a different way of looking at it. In modern American culture, competitiveness is held to be a virtue. We like to think of ourselves as compassionate (read: good), but is our core competitiveness a stumbling block to compassion that thinks not of oneself?

He recommended that I read a book by Henry Nouwen entitled "Compassion".
